Safer Recruitment Training – CPD-Certified 5-in-1 Bundle

Safer Recruitment Training provides a practical understanding of safer hiring practices used to protect children, young people, and vulnerable adults. The course covers recruitment procedures, risk awareness, pre-employment checks, interviewing techniques, and safeguarding responsibilities to support compliant and responsible recruitment decisions.
